Strong's Hebrew · H2821

חָשַׁךְ

châshak · khaw-shak'

be black, be (make) dark, darken, cause darkness, be dim, hide.

Definition

to be dark (as withholding light); transitively, to darken

Derivation

a primitive root;

Appears 17 times in Scripture

Psalms 69:23

May their eyes be darkened so they cannot see, and their backs be bent forever.

Isaiah 5:30

In that day they will roar over it, like the roaring of the sea. If one looks over the land, he will see darkness and distress; even the light will be obscured by clouds.

Ecclesiastes 12:3

on the day the keepers of the house tremble and the strong men stoop, when those grinding cease because they are few and those watching through windows see dimly,

Exodus 10:15

They covered the face of all the land until it was black, and they consumed all the plants on the ground and all the fruit on the trees that the hail had left behind. Nothing green was left on any tree or plant in all the land of Egypt.

Psalms 139:12

even the darkness is not dark to You, but the night shines like the day, for darkness is as light to You.

Job 3:9

May its morning stars grow dark; may it wait in vain for daylight; may it not see the breaking of dawn.

Job 38:2

“Who is this who obscures My counsel by words without knowledge?

Job 18:6

The light in his tent grows dark, and the lamp beside him goes out.

Ecclesiastes 12:2

before the light of the sun, moon, and stars is darkened, and the clouds return after the rain,

Psalms 105:28

He sent darkness, and it became dark—yet they defied His words.
